UNC baseball pitches forward in season
Posted Apr 17, 2013
Much to-do has been made about the No. 1 North Carolina baseball team’s offense this season — and rightfully so — but outfielder Skye Bolt’s injury served as a reminder that the real strength of the team is in its pitching. None of this is news to senior center fielder Chaz Frank.
